Bemidji State University is a comprehensive, public, and regional institution in Bemidji, Minnesota. Founded in 1919 to meet an urgent demand for teachers, it was a major pathway to higher education for northern Minnesotans throughout most of the twentieth century. Bemidji State now has a broader scope, serving about 5,000 undergraduate and graduate students from across Minnesota, from surrounding states, and from around the world. Buoyed by the success of its first comprehensive fundraising campaign — exceeding a $35 million, five-year goal in gifts and pledges — the university aspires to reflect Minnesota’s increasing diversity while rising to the challenges and opportunities of a global century.

 

BSU offers broad access to high-quality, affordable higher education, providing the academic guidance and personal encouragement students need in order to exceed their own expectations and achieve at the highest levels.
